Answer:
We know the amount of discount is $10. Therefore, mentally we know the
following:
Sale price = $100 - $10 = $90
We know the Sales Tax is 5%. We can first take 10% of 90 because all we have to
do is move the decimal point one place to the left. Therefore, 10% of 90 equals
$9. Then we divide this number in half to represent 5%. Therefore, 9/2 = $4.50.
The Sales Tax is $4.50.
Total Cost = $90 + $4.50 = $94.50 Explanations may vary.
Sale Price = $90
Sales Tax = $4.50
Total Cost = $94.50
